50Hertz and Energinet have joined forces to fully harvest the offshore wind potential held in the Baltic Sea, power the green transition in Germany and Denmark, and spearhead a new idea for connecting offshore wind farms across borders: the Bornholm Energy Island (BEI) project. This innovative and visionary project will connect multiple wind farms together via a single hub and transport the green electricity that they generate to consumers in both countries while providing transmission capacity for cross-border trading.

Together, 50Hertz and Energinet want to establish a power hub on the island of Bornholm that is able to provide electricity to consumers in either country, depending on the market and demand in Germany, Denmark and Europe more widely. Electricity generated by the wind farms located off the coast of the island will be centralised at this hub and then converted into high-voltage direct current (HVDC) and transported via 525 kV HVDC sea and land cable systems to onshore substations in Zealand (in Denmark) and Mecklenburg-Western Pomerania (in Germany). In addition, the BEI project will enable the local community on the island to be connected to both Zealand and continental Europe.
Cooperation between countries is the way forward
50Hertz and Energinet are pioneering innovators. BEI will pave the way to a future in which offshore wind energy is no longer harvested by individual countries alone. Instead, in line with the offshore wind potential held by different countries and electricity demand in these, two or more countries will cooperate to efficiently integrate the green electricity generated by offshore wind farms into their energy systems.
We at 50Hertz and Energinet hold a significant amount of expertise in feeding electricity from offshore wind farms into our power grids. The Kriegers Flak - Combined Grid Solution (KF CGS), our joint project which has been fully operational since 2021, laid the foundations for making hybrid interconnectors a reality in both the Baltic Sea and the North Sea. We will continue to use our know-how to implement ever-evolving, more complex and more efficient on- and offshore energy hubs.

Bornholm Energy Island takes next step with construction contract award
Energinet has awarded the contract for the buildings that will house key electrical infrastructure for Bornholm Energy Island in Denmark to Per Aarsleff A/S - a Danish contracting and infrastructure group with experience in large and complex construction projects. The award marks another important step in the joint Danish-German project developed by Energinet and 50Hertz.
The contract covers buildings for three converter stations in Denmark — one on Zealand and two on Bornholm — as well as the building for a new 400 kV high-voltage station on Bornholm. It also includes site preparation, access roads and related civil works around the station areas.
Bornholm Energy Island is being developed jointly by the two transmission system operators Energinet in Denmark and 50Hertz in Germany. The project will connect offshore wind power in the Baltic Sea with the electricity grids in Denmark and Germany and support a more integrated and resilient European energy system.
With the selection of Aarsleff, the project moves further towards the construction phase. The coming period will focus on detailed design and planning before construction is expected to begin in 2027.
Once completed, the infrastructure will help collect and transmit large amounts of renewable electricity from future offshore wind farms near Bornholm to consumers in Denmark and Germany.

Architecture and landscape integration on Bornholm: The contractor’s proposal uses materials, colours and landscaping that reference Bornholm’s geology and landscape for the projects main station on Bornholm. Concrete bases, natural stone façades and earthy tones give the buildings a calm architectural expression, while planting, terrain modelling and pathways help screen the facility and integrate it into the surrounding landscape in line with the local plan.

Buildings for the key facilities on Bornholm: The visualisation shows the largest buildings to be constructed on Bornholm: four converter halls and a GIS building. The area marked “Construction Site Facilities and Laydown for BEI” on the map is reserved for future DC breakers. They are not part of the current project, but they have been included in the planning, as they are essential for future connections.
Energinet is an independent public enterprise owned by the Danish Ministry of Climate, Energy and Utilities. Energinet owns, operates and develops the transmission systems for electricity and gas in Denmark. Energinet’s purpose is to own, operate and develop the overall energy infrastructure and manage related tasks, thus contributing to the development of a climate-neutral energy supply.
50Hertz operates the electricity transmission system in the north and east of Germany, which it expands as needed for the energy transition. Within these regions, 50Hertz and its around 2,100 employees ensure that 18 million people are supplied with electricity around the clock. 50Hertz is a forerunner in the field of secure integration of renewable energy. In our grid area, we want to integrate 100 percent renewable energies securely into the grid and system by 2032 - calculated over the year. The shareholders of 50Hertz are the Belgian holding Elia Group (80 percent), which is listed on the stock exchange, and the KfW bank group with 20 percent.
